Franco Sessa, Cheeselinks' New Zealand rep and NZ Ambassador for the International Cheese and Dairy Award (UK), served as a judge at the 2026 NZ Vegan Cheese Awards, hosted by the Vegan Society of Aotearoa. Joining him on the panel were culinary arts scholar Tracy Berno, food technology specialist Aaron Pucci, vegan pie champion Jason Hay, and actor Tom Sainsbury.
The Supreme Winner was Savour Vegan Creamery's "Cashbert", a cultured cashew Camembert with a genuine mould-ripened rind, praised by the panel as "unctuous and tasty, a perfect addition to any cheeseboard." Standout performers across the categories included Let Them Eat Vegan collecting multiple Gold medals, Epic Foods taking top honours in Feta and Flavoured Cheddar, Zenzo winning Gold for Mozzarella, and One Love Planet earning medals across a wide range of artisan styles.
Cheeselinks' focus is dairy. We supply specialist cultures, rennet, mould spores, and equipment for dairy cheesemakers and commercial producers across Australia and New Zealand. But the techniques behind the best results at these awards are the same disciplines that underpin quality dairy cheesemaking: controlled fermentation, mould-ripening, pH management, and affinage. The craft is not different. The substrate is.
The standard being set by NZ producers in this space reflects the same technical rigour and artisan commitment that defines quality cheesemaking in all its forms.
